Time zones seem simple until you need them in everyday life. A quick call to Hawaii, a meeting with colleagues in the United States, a customer in the United Kingdom or family in another time zone: suddenly you need to know what time it is there.
VistaBoard can show an additional time zone with time and date. That means you see not only your local time, but also the time at a second place. This is especially useful if you regularly interact with people in other countries.
Privately, a time zone tile helps with family, friends or travel. If relatives live abroad, you can immediately see whether it is morning, evening or the middle of the night there. That prevents badly timed calls and makes spontaneous messages more considerate.
At work, it is just as useful. Remote work, international customers, suppliers or support requests often span several time zones. A visible second clock reduces scheduling mistakes and makes video calls easier to plan.
Date and weekday matter too. With larger time differences, the other place may already be on the next day. A clock alone is often not enough. The combination of location, time and date makes the display truly practical.
The advantage over a phone app is visibility. You do not need to search, open an app or calculate the difference. The information is calmly visible on the wall whenever you need it.
